            Hanninger Flats Campground, a popular campside of Pasadena, is reached through multiple trails with a strenous uphill hike. The camping is free of charge and the campsite is well-maintained, furnished with restrooms, picninc tables and a ranger station.

            Located in Pasadena, the Eaton Canyon Nature Preserve is a beautiful natural area full of hiking trails, streams, mineral deposits and native wildlife. The Preserve also has a large visitors' center, a film theater, classrooms and an information desk.

            A popular place for birthday parties and children events in Montebello is the Montebello Barnyard Zoo. The zoo offers pony rides, picnic areas, a petting zoo, train rides and a vintage carousel.

            Contained within the extensive Angeles National Forest are scenic natural environments, campgrounds, picnic tables, fishing areas, hiking trails, and ski trails. The forest also holds the San Gabriel Mountains National Monument.

            Spanning a total of 10,700 square-feet, Bonita Skate Park is a park popular among local skateboarders and in-line skaters. The park features a variety of rails, drops, and ramps for skaters to enjoy.

            Montebello Batting Cages has six different batting cages with wheel machines, including one fast pitch softball machine and one lob softball machine. Pitches reach speeds of 40-90 mph and sessions last 15 minutes.

            A part of the Eisenhower Community Park, Arcadia's Dog Park is a leash free dog park that spans 3/4 acre. The park offers separate fenced areas for small dogs and large dogs.
